Sat 1374276080152989

decimal
339710.1080152989
degree
0°129710′1022″1080152989‴
percentile
65.4417181745092%
name
ecqfekdiubc
cycle
0
epoch
1
period
168
block
339710
offset
1080152989
timestamp
rarity
common